Output 940122287859d3460d387e8e8d9253f5f89b205a512640ae24423934a551aebb:2

value
9645844
script pubkey
OP_0 OP_PUSHBYTES_20 aa43b172eceecca482ac798063cb621ed7c4ef2c
address
bc1q4fpmzuhvamx2fq4v0xqx8jmzrmtufmev2yr3e2
transaction
940122287859d3460d387e8e8d9253f5f89b205a512640ae24423934a551aebb
confirmations
210944
spent
true